In a 1997 Honda Civic EX, the fuel pump is located inside the fuel tank. The fuel pump relay is typically found in the under-hood fuse/relay box, which is near the battery. You can identify the relay by checking the diagram on the cover of the fuse box for the specific relay associated with the fuel pump. If you need to access the fuel pump, you'll have to remove the fuel tank from the vehicle.
